Reinstate Jon Jacobson at Diamond Peak

The Issue

We, the undersigned students, friends, and co-workers of Jon Jacobson believe he was wrongfully terminated and should be reinstated. 

Jon is an excellent instructor both in terms of his technical knowledge as well as his ability to work with people, and convey that knowledge. 

In our interactions with him, he has always and without exception conducted himself in a professional and ethical manner. We have never experienced or heard of him posing any threat, physically or otherwise to any customer, employee or student at the ski school at Diamond Peak. To the contrary, he has always been helpful and exhibited a positive attitude and exemplary behavior while he was at the resort.

Jon's termination would be a significant loss for the program, would reflect poorly on the resort, and would negatively affect the sense of community which is so important to Diamond Peak. His unfair and unwarranted termination will certainly negatively and unfairly affect his reputation and career as a ski instructor and his overall future employment, and will further reflection poorly on Diamond Peak and affect its ability to recruit and retain talented instructors. 

For the foregoing reasons we are requesting that Jon be reinstated.
